Invader MT cleanup project
My Invader MT was looking pretty sad. It wasn't that it was heavily used, but the previous owner converted it to a pan car by trimming the axle and pod down and undoing all the mt stuff. I had a Invader Dirt Oval that was a new built that gave its life to become the new platform for this resoration. I first set up some AJ's tires that I thought would be close enough, but they just didn't look right- so luckily the stock tires cleaned up pretty well. I am still searching for a proper rear axle for it, but since it is MT specific it will take a while
